Advantages of Dacron Cotton Stainless Steel Braided PTFE Hose
Chemical resistance:
It is inert to almost all commercial chemicals, acids, alcohols, coolants, elastomers, petroleum compounds, solvents, vinyl, synthetic lubricants, and hydraulic fluids.
Bending and impact resistance:
Not affected by continuous bending, vibration or impact - can withstand alternating hot and cold cycles.
Low friction coefficient:
Low friction coefficient and anti viscosity performance ensure continuous low pressure drop during use, with good rated pressure and full vacuum.
Light weight:
Easier to move, handle and install than rubber hose with a comparable burst pressure rating - ideal as a pigtail in gas handling and pneumatic systems where the dew point must be low.
Inviscid:
Handle various substances such as adhesives, mortars, dyes, grease, glue, latex, paint and paint - when used as a compressed discharge line, no carbon build-up.
Pollution-free:
Does not contaminate materials, fluids, gas conduction – 
PTFE is FDA approved for food handling and pharmaceutical applications.
Anti metamorphism:
Weather resistant, long-term storage, no aging during use.
Steam compatibility:
Due to the high temperature and high pressure resistance of PTFE, it is very suitable for steam applications.
Thermal insulation:
In high temperature conditions, it can be a good thermal insulation, so as not to cause operator burns.
Prettier appearance:
In automotive applications, black Dacron cotton layer makes the hose look prettier and matches your black aluminum alloy fittings.
Dacron Cotton Stainless Steel Braided PTFE Hose
| No. | Inner diameter | Outer diameter | Tube Wall
Thickness | Working pressure | Burst pressure | sleeve size | 
| (inch) | (mm±0.2) | (inch) | (mm±0.2) | (inch) | (mm±0.1) | (psi) | (bar) | (psi) | (bar) | 
| ZXGM102/112-03 | 1/8" | 3.5 | 0.295 | 7.5 | 0.039 | 1.00 | 3444 | 238 | 13775 | 950 | ZXTF0-02 | 
| ZXGM102/112-04 | 3/16" | 5.0 | 0.354 | 9.0 | 0.033 | 0.85 | 2998 | 207 | 11992 | 827 | ZXTF0-03 | 
| ZXGM102/112-05 | 1/4" | 6.5 | 0.413 | 10.5 | 0.033 | 0.85 | 2719 | 188 | 10875 | 750 | ZXTF0-04 | 
| ZXGM102/112-06 | 5/16" | 8.0 | 0.472 | 12.0 | 0.033 | 0.85 | 2393 | 165 | 9570 | 660 | ZXTF0-05 | 
| ZXGM102/112-08 | 3/8" | 10.0 | 0.571 | 14.5 | 0.033 | 0.85 | 2008 | 139 | 8033 | 554 | ZXTF0-06 | 
| ZXGM102/112-10 | 1/2" | 13.0 | 0.709 | 18.0 | 0.039 | 1.00 | 1856 | 128 | 7424 | 512 | ZXTF0-08 | 
| ZXGM102/112-12 | 5/8" | 16.0 | 0.819 | 20.8 | 0.039 | 1.00 | 1243 | 86 | 4974 | 343 | ZXTF0-10 | 
| ZXGM102/112-14 | 3/4" | 19.0 | 0.984 | 25.0 | 0.047 | 1.20 | 1051 | 73 | 4205 | 290 | ZXTF0-12 | 
| ZXGM102/112-16 | 7/8" | 22.2 | 1.122 | 28.5 | 0.047 | 1.20 | 885 | 61 | 3538 | 244 | ZXTF0-14 | 
| ZXGM102/112-18 | 1" | 25.0 | 1.260 | 32.0 | 0.059 | 1.50 | 834 | 58 | 3335 | 230 | ZXTF0-16 |
